Transaction 26504600e3df9e44ccad5dff389de6b0dbf1c1551ade9bd17a02b4feaa81da18
1 Input
1 Output
-
26504600e3df9e44ccad5dff389de6b0dbf1c1551ade9bd17a02b4feaa81da18:0
- value
- 63439289
- script pubkey
- OP_0 OP_PUSHBYTES_20 dc3967e6d47277fdb32f721ce9515cdfc6ba657d
- address
- bc1qmsuk0ek5wfmlmve0wgwwj52umlrt5eta5lgzgg